  • Big Brother Naija 10/10 Week 2 Recap: Danboski Evicted

    We have a complete rundown of everything that happened, including their wager task, head of house drama, and the beef between Dede and Sultana.

    Another week has come and gone in the Big Brother Naija 10/10 house, filled with a lot of fights, drama, and new ships that sailed. We have a complete rundown of everything that happened, including their wager task, head of house drama, and the beef between Dede and Sultana.

    Week Head of House Challenge Highlights

    Thelma Lawson鈥檚 Brief Head of House Reign

    Thelma Lawson kicked off Week 2 in power, winning the initial Head of House challenge and becoming the season鈥檚 first female HoH. She chose Kayikunmi as her guest in the HoH lounge, a move that cemented her authority鈥攁t least for a moment.

    Victory Dethrones Thelma

    The next day, a title-defence challenge was introduced. Thelma had to defend her crown against contenders including Victory, Ivatar, Jason Jae, and Dede. After several intense rounds, Victory emerged victorious, replacing her as Head of House.

    Victory鈥檚 Post-Win Choices and Drama

    Victory鈥檚 HoH win drew immediate attention, but his decisions stirred drama. Instead of choosing Gigi Jasmine鈥攈is apparent romantic interest鈥攁s his lounge guest, he picked Joanna. Gigi was visibly hurt, and fans began questioning whether this was a bold game strategy or a betrayal of trust. He also saved Kayikunmi and not Bright Morgan, his closest friend in the house.

    Wager Task Outcome: Team Meat-Based Triumphs

    This week鈥檚 wager presentation saw housemates split into two groups to debate which diet is healthier 鈥 plant-based or meat-based. The contest unfolded in four stages: introductions, main arguments, rebuttals, and closing statements. While both sides put in a strong effort, Team Meat-Based stood out with a sharp opening and powerful rebuttals, ultimately impressing Big Brother enough to secure the win.

    Their victory earned them control over the kitchen and the week鈥檚 shopping list. Key contributors to the win included Thelma Lawson, Ivatar, and Faith, whose strategic thinking and confident delivery played a major role in the team鈥檚 success.

    Week 2 Major Fights

    Ivatar vs. Joanna & Big Soso

    Tensions boiled over during rehearsals for the week鈥檚 wager task when Joanna missed her cue. Ivatar confronted her, and Big Soso jumped in to defend Joanna. What started as a correction quickly turned into a heated shouting match, with accusations of disrespect and unprofessionalism flying from all sides.

    Bright Morgan vs. Kayikunmi

    The tension between Bright and Kayikunmi reached a tipping point this week. Their verbal jabs escalated until Big Brother himself had to step in to break up the altercation.

    Gigi Jasmine vs. Faith

    After Faith鈥檚 team won a task, Gigi Jasmine mocked him, throwing in body-shaming remarks. Faith fired back, threatening that he could 鈥渇ight all of you,鈥 sparking one of the most intense verbal clashes of the week.

    Kayikunmi vs. Bright Morgan

    Another notable clash happened between Kayikunmi and Bright Morgan during a poolside conversation. What started as playful banter turned sour after Kayikunmi called Birght a 鈥渂itch.鈥

    Zita vs. Mide

    What began as a small disagreement over how to cut carrots in the kitchen spiralled into a major confrontation. According to housemates, Zita even swung a pot at Mide before others intervened to prevent it from becoming physical.

    Kaypobbo vs. Mensah

    One of the most intense confrontations of the week came when Kaypobbo and Mensah went head-to-head in a heated argument. What began as a disagreement over chores quickly spiraled into a loud shouting match. Both men accused each other of disrespect and arrogance, with fellow housemates stepping in to prevent the situation from escalating further.

    Week 2 Ships and Relationship Highlights

    Bride (Bright & Mide)

    The standout ship this week was 鈥淏ride鈥濃擝right and Mide. Their chemistry reached a peak during the Thursday pool party, where they shared a bold kiss that set social media ablaze. Their playful, intimate moments in the house quickly made them one of the most talked-about couples of the season.

    Jason & Dede

    Jason, the Week 1 Head of House, opened up to Dede in a heartfelt moment, telling her he didn鈥檛 want to be 鈥渙ne of [her] numerous boys.鈥 He admitted that he valued a special connection with her and wanted something more meaningful than casual house flings.

    Danboskid & Zita

    Danboskid and Zita鈥檚 ship grew quietly but steadily, with cosy moments under the duvet and soft, flirtatious exchanges. Their slow-burn romance has already made them a fan favourite.

    Koyin & Sultana

    Koyin and Sultana turned heads after sharing a passionate kiss at the pool party. While some fans saw it as a genuine spark, others speculated it might be a strategic move to keep both housemates in the spotlight.

    Kayikunmi & Isabella

    Kayikunmi and Isabella鈥檚 dynamic was one of the week鈥檚 most dramatic. A viral clip showed Isabella baring her chest for Kayikunmi during a lighthearted moment. Days later, she admitted that only Kaybobo and Kola were her true 鈥渟pecs鈥 in the house鈥攁 revelation that raised questions about the sincerity of her feelings for Kayikunmi.

    Week 2 Major Highlights

    Bright Morgan vs. His Social Media Handler

    The biggest controversy of the week erupted when Bright Morgan鈥檚 social media handler accused him of sexually assaulting Mide, his love interest in the house. The claims, posted on his official account, described inappropriate touching while Mide was asleep. However, in the video footage, Mide appeared awake and engaged in conversation during the moment in question. The allegations sparked heated debates both inside and outside the house, with Bright鈥檚 family issuing a statement in his defence.

    Sultana鈥檚 Shocking 鈥淒rama鈥 with Dede鈥檚 Box

    In perhaps the most bizarre turn of Week 2, housemate Doris revealed that Sultana peed in Dede鈥檚 box. According to Doris, the housemates had to unpack, sort, and hand-wash Dede鈥檚 clothes to clean up the mess鈥攁ll while Sultana refused to offer any apology, instead accusing Doris of 鈥渢ransferring aggression.鈥 Whether it was drunken behaviour or something more deliberate, the moment sent the house and online chatter into overdrive.

    Week 2 Evicted Housemates

    Danboski Evicted

    Ebuka announced Danboski as the first housemate to leave the BBNaija 10/10 house in Week 2. Danboski was in a ship with Zita.

    Ibifubara Evicted

    Following Danboski鈥檚 exit, Ebuka revealed that Ibifubara would also be leaving the BBNaija 10/10 house. Calm but strategic, Ibifubara often played a low-key game, building alliances quietly rather than dominating conversations.
